Matt, Gary and George will have you speaking gourmet with MasterChef Australia

The MasterChef judges hope to inspire even more home cooks in India with the new season.

The culinary extravaganza, MasterChef Australia, is back with its 8th season and, for the first time ever, will air right after its international telecast exclusively on Star World and Star World HD from 9th May onwards.

Over the years, MasterChef Australia has not only entertained audiences with beautiful food and compelling stories but has also inspired and exposed hundreds of around the world to a food revolution.

Talking about the show and it’s new season ,celebrated food writer and MasterChef Australia judge Matt Preston said, “MasterChef Australia has created food connoisseurs over the world. To know that MasterChef Australia has encouraged and motivated viewers across the world to not only cook better but also live better is a huge testimony to its popularity. Having visited India multiple times, I am elated and humbled at how popular the show and we are with fans. Here’s to another scintillating and inspiring season!”

Talking about the upcoming season, renowned chef and MasterChef Australia judge Gary Mehigan said, “I’m extremely proud to be associated with a show like MasterChef Australia that, over the years, has become one of the best apprenticeships offered across the world. I am aware of the huge fan following the show enjoys in India and I’m hoping we can inspire even more home cooks in India with the new season.”

Chef and judge George Calombaris known for his catchy phrases added, “MasterChef Australia is back with a new season that is ready to push more boundaries with never-seen-before food and talent. We are excited to see the level of creativity and skill that the new contestants bring to the table under the tutelage of our esteemed mentors this year. We are ready to boom-boom shake the room!”
